#6999D1 Hex Color Code

#6999D1

The Hexadecimal Color #6999D1 is a contrast shade of Corn Flower Blue. #6999D1 RGB value is rgb(105, 153, 209). RGB Color Model of #6999D1 consists of 41% red, 60% green and 81% blue. HSL color Mode of #6999D1 has 212°(degrees) Hue, 53% Saturation and 62% Lightness. #6999D1 color has an wavelength of 486.51852n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#6999D1 is #99CCFF.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#6999D1 is #69C. The Closest Color to #6999D1 is #6495ED. Official Name of #6999D1 Hex Code is Danube.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#6999D1 is 50 Cyan 27 Magenta 0 Yellow 18 Black and #6999D1 CMY is 50, 27,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#6999D1 is hsl(212,53,62,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(212, 50, 82).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#6999D1 is 28.72, 30.39, 64.66.
Hex8 Value of #6999D1 is #6999D1FF. Decimal Value of #6999D1 is 6920657 and Octal Value of #6999D1 is 32314721. Binary Value of #6999D1 is 1101001, 10011001, 11010001 and Android of #6999D1 is 4285110737 / 0xff6999d1.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#6999D1 is 0.232, 0.246, 0.246 and YIQ Color Space of #6999D1 is 145.032, -46.596, 7.2752.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#6999D1 is 23.6, 31.77, 64.09.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#6999D1 is 61.99, -0.64, -33.64.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#6999D1 is 61.99, -23.0, -52.6.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#6999D1 is 61.99, 33.65, 268.91. Hunter Lab variable of #6999D1 is 55.13, -3.48, -30.95.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#6999D1

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
